FedNow Trails Behind RTP Network in Real-Time Payments
The Federal Reserve's instant payments system, FedNow, and The Clearing House's RTP network are competing for dominance in real-time payments in the US. A recent report by the Richmond Fed compared the growth of both systems.
FedNow has connected to 1,725 U.S. banks and credit unions since its launch in July 2023, but still lags behind RTP's transaction volume. In the second quarter, RTP processed 142 million transactions valued at $480 billion, while FedNow handled about 5 million transactions.
The report noted that despite being newer, FedNow has higher enrollment than RTP from both banks and credit unions. However, RTP maintains connections to a greater percentage of total demand deposits due to stronger adoption among large financial institutions.
